How to Reach

There are several ways to reach Miri from Niah National Park:

  • By Bus: Direct buses are available from Niah town to Miri. The journey takes about 2 hours and costs around MYR 20-30.
  • By Car: A rental car is a convenient option and allows for flexibility. The drive takes about 1.5 hours.
  • By Taxi: Taxis are available but can be expensive. The fare from Niah to Miri typically ranges from MYR 150-200.

Best time to go

The best time to visit Miri is during the dry season, which runs from March to October. During this time, you can expect less rain and more sunshine.

Where to Go

In addition to the Niah Caves, which are a must-see in Niah National Park, Miri has several other attractions worth exploring:

  • Lambir Hills National Park: A rainforest park with hiking trails, waterfalls, and wildlife.
  • Miri City Fan: A waterfront promenade with shops, restaurants, and a panoramic view of the city.
  • Canada Hill: A hilltop park offering stunning views of Miri and the surrounding area.
